What companies run services between Neuss, Germany and Gießen, Germany?

You can take a train from Neuss Hbf to Gießen Bahnhof via Koeln Hbf, Frankfurt(Main)Hbf, and Frankfurt in around 4h 6m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Düsseldorf central bus station to Gießen twice daily. Tickets cost €15–25 and the journey takes 3h 21m.
